Professional Experience

National Security & Public Service

Matt brings a lifelong dedication to service and a valuable diverse background to the firm. He has wide-ranging experience in national security, strategic communication, advocacy and public affairs. As an associate under the national security sector at Booz Allen Hamilton, he served as an operations chief and information operations planner on a counter adversary team supporting U.S. Cyber Command.

Matt is a decorated combat veteran, having served as a commissioned officer in the U.S. Army. He has extensive experience in special operations, intelligence and information advantage. He deployed overseas in the Middle East and Europe as part of Operation Enduring Freedom, Operation Inherent Resolve and Operation Atlantic Resolve.   

This military background provides a strong foundation for his current role in government relations and consulting, where he advises clients navigating complex policy, communications and interagency environments. His work in civil-military and influence operations, international relations and diplomacy directly supports strategic engagement and stakeholder coordination efforts.

Prior to this, Matt spent several years as a professional fire fighter and medic for a busy city department, responding to thousands of complex emergencies and leading federal grant, education and fundraising initiatives.

Government, Policy & Communications

Earlier in his career, Matt held roles in government, politics and communications. He managed public affairs for Kinder Morgan, overseeing outreach, lobbying and stakeholder engagement on major energy projects for the Fortune 500 company nationwide. He was also a Congressional staffer and campaign political director for former U.S. Congresswoman Elizabeth Esty.
